Planting through plastic will protect the fruit from slugs and earth splashes, alternatively, mulch around the strawberry plant with chipped bark or straw when the fruit has set (if growing everbearers avoid straw as this can encourage fungal disease if used over an extended period of time). European tarnished plant bug on strawberries and other soft fruits European tarnished plant bug is a damaging pest of mid- and late season strawberry crops and an occasional pest of raspberry and other cane fruits. Be careful to plant so that the crown of the plant (the point from which the leaves emerge) is at the soil surface. It is unwise to accept gifts of plants from old strawberry beds – these will almost certainly be infected with one or more viruses, although of course, if the yield is still good the risk may be worth taking; Destroy and replace plants as soon as yields start to fall, usually after two or three years. Strawberries are one of the highest value per-acre crops grown in North America with annual yields ranging from 4 to 20 tons/acre and gross values ranging from $2,800 to $14,000 per acre (Schaefers 1981).
